In modern construction and industrial engineering, FRP tubes are gaining popularity due to their high strength, lightweight design, and excellent corrosion resistance. But what exactly is an FRP tube, and why is it increasingly replacing traditional materials like steel and aluminum? This article answers those questions and more.


Definition of FRP Tube

FRP stands for Fiber Reinforced Plastic, and an FRP tube refers to a tubular structure made by reinforcing plastic resin with strong fibers—typically glass fiber. These tubes are manufactured through processes like pultrusion, filament winding, or centrifugal casting. The result is a rigid, durable, and versatile component suitable for demanding applications.

There are several types of FRP tubes, including:

  • FRP square tube

  • FRP round tube

  • Rectangular fiberglass tubes

  • Customized FRP structural tubes

Each type is available in various sizes, wall thicknesses, and colors, depending on the intended use.


Key Properties of FRP Tubes

  1. Lightweight but Strong
    Compared to steel tubes, FRP vs steel tube comparisons consistently show that FRP offers similar strength at a fraction of the weight.

  2. Corrosion Resistance
    FRP tubes are highly resistant to moisture, acids, salts, and chemicals. This makes them ideal for marine, wastewater, and chemical plant applications.

  3. Electrical Insulation
    Unlike metal tubes, fiberglass tubes do not conduct electricity, making them perfect for use in electrical infrastructure.

  4. UV and Weather Resistance
    UV-stabilized FRP tubes can withstand harsh outdoor conditions without degradation.


Common Applications of FRP Tubes

  • Structural Supports: Ideal for handrails, ladders, and framework in corrosive environments.

  • Electrical Infrastructure: Used in cable trays, conduits, and insulating components.

  • Marine & Offshore: FRP tubes resist saltwater, making them suitable for boat masts, docks, and platforms.

  • Industrial Equipment: Used in cooling towers, scrubbers, and storage tanks.

  • Recreational Equipment: Common in tent poles, kite frames, and fishing rods.


FRP Tube vs. Other Materials

Property

FRP Tube

Steel Tube

Aluminum Tube





Weight

Very Light

Heavy

Light

Corrosion Resistance

Excellent

Poor (unless treated)

Good

Electrical Conductivity

None

Conductive

Conductive

Maintenance

Low

High

Medium

Cost

Moderate

Low (initial)

Moderate

While FRP tubes may have a slightly higher initial cost, their long-term benefits in durability and low maintenance often offset this.
